Transaction 75a89818bbaa02aa3188193fd0a39e6d0f7945cab91a230c110b3e1d6399c3dc
1 Input
1 Output
-
75a89818bbaa02aa3188193fd0a39e6d0f7945cab91a230c110b3e1d6399c3dc:0
- value
- 167372
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 362c45c3a76f5746e872491f5f74753a13817d64 OP_EQUAL
- address
- 36dTT1bCoEzhK6oDDkuDvaSHPNLX6fsKEg